St. John the Baptist Parish, LA (April 14, 2026) – Eastbound lanes on Airline Highway at Windsor Boulevard were temporarily closed following a multi-vehicle crash, according to the St. John the Baptist Parish Sheriff’s Office.
The crash was reported in the early hours of Tuesday, April 14, prompting emergency response and traffic control in the area. Authorities confirmed that the eastbound lanes have since reopened to traffic.
Entergy crews remained on scene working to restore traffic signal operation after the collision damaged or disrupted the lights at the intersection. Officials have not released details regarding the number of vehicles involved or the extent of injuries.
Investigators are continuing to review the circumstances surrounding the crash, and more information may be provided as it becomes available. No additional details have been confirmed at this time.

What Happens After a Multi-Vehicle Crash at a Signalized Intersection?
When a crash occurs at a signalized intersection, traffic control systems like lights may be damaged or temporarily disrupted. This can lead to delays as utility crews work to restore normal operation and ensure the area is safe for drivers.
Multi-vehicle crashes at intersections often require investigators to review signal timing, vehicle positions, and roadway conditions. These early steps help determine how the collision unfolded.
Even after lanes reopen, traffic patterns may remain slower than usual while cleanup and repairs are completed. Drivers are typically encouraged to use extra caution when passing through intersections where signals are not fully functioning.
